As the BI & Data Analytics Manager you will be responsible for defining and driving Analytics and Data Warehouse architecture and also democratize data working closely with various departments, by building easy to use Analytics. You will be responsible for designing and developing strategies for data quality, architecture, definition and data insight. 

This position will primarily be responsible for creating and maintaining key organizational reports, a single source of truth (via data warehouse), acting as a gatekeeper for data integrity and security, and supporting the organization's growing analytical needs and capabilities. You will be responsible for partnering with business in developing and delivering data-driven solutions for various organization and for customers. You will also develop AI/ML models to solve key business and technical challenges with data-driven innovation. The complexity of this position requires a leadership approach that is engaging, imaginative, and collaborative, with a sophisticated ability to work with other leaders to drive consensus towards common data definition, metrics and priorities.

    Penumbra, Inc., headquartered in Alameda, California, is a global healthcare company focused on innovative therapies. Penumbra designs, develops, manufactures, and markets novel products and has a broad portfolio that addresses challenging medical conditions in markets with significant unmet need. Penumbra sells its products to hospitals and healthcare providers primarily through its direct sales organization in the United States, most of Europe, Canada, and Australia, and through distributors in select international markets.
